URGENT UPDATE: As Thanksgiving approaches, Fight2Feed, a dedicated food rescue organization in Chicago, is amplifying its call for volunteers to combat hunger this holiday season. The nonprofit is ramping up initiatives to ensure that no one in the community goes hungry.

Founded on March 20, 2014, Fight2Feed has made a significant impact by saving unused, uncooked, and prepared food from restaurants, grocery stores, and major conventions. The organization is entirely volunteer-driven, distributing meals from its headquarters to community partners across Chicago and three surrounding counties: Will, DuPage, and Lake County.

Since its inception, Fight2Feed has served over 2 million meals and rescued more than 6 million pounds of food that would have otherwise gone to waste. This holiday season, they aim to expand their efforts, calling for immediate volunteer support specifically on Wednesdays and Saturdays from 8:30 AM to 2:30 PM.

“We hope to feed thousands of people and ensure that no one goes hungry,” a representative from Fight2Feed stated.

This initiative is especially crucial as the holiday season often sees a heightened need for food assistance. Fight2Feed partners with local nonprofits that provide food, shelter, and resources to the unhoused, under-resourced, and immigrant communities.
